What is asexual reproduction in plants?

Hint: Asexual reproduction is a type of reproduction in which a child is born from a single parent. Simply put, this mode of reproduction is the process by which an entity reproduces a replica of itself. Asexual Reproduction occurs when the parent body splits or separates to form a new organism.

Asexual Reproduction Characteristics:
Asexual reproduction entities exhibit some distinguishing characteristics, a few of which are listed below:
Because it is a uniparental condition, genetically identical offspring are produced, which is advantageous when the parents are well adapted to their surroundings.
Fertilization is not part of the process because gametes are not involved.
The only mitosis is observed as a type of cell division.
This is the quickest method of reproduction.
Different Asexual Reproduction Methods in Plants:
Budding– This is a process that occurs primarily in yeast cells. Buds are small, bulb-like projections that emerge from fully grown and matured yeast cells. New yeast cells are formed from the parent cell in this mode of reproduction.
Fragmentation – In this asexual reproduction process, the new plant is created from a portion of the parent plant which grows, matures, and develops into an individual plant.
Spore formation – This is a process that occurs in all non-flowering plants as well as algae. Spores develop by germinating into a new individual under certain favorable conditions. Plants such as ferns and mosses reproduce through spores as well.
Vegetative Propagation – This asexual reproduction process occurs from plant vegetative parts such as roots, stems, or buds.
Note:
Self-propagation is a natural method of asexual reproduction. The following are the various ways in which a plant can self-produce:
1. Plants such as ginger, onion, dahlia, and potato sprout from buds on the stem's surface. On the surface of a stem tuber, there are several eyes. These eyes sprout leafy shoots when conditions are favorable.
2. New plants can grow from adventitious buds or stolons in sweet potatoes.
3. The small buds on the margins of the leaves in Bryophyllum become detached and grow into an independent plant.
